    Stephen R.

    Took a day trip to Ville Platte, LA. Stop here for lunch. Not many customers and not sure why as the food was good. If you are around Main Street look on the corner for this restaurant. We drove by it the first time and had to u-turn and come back to it. Just be aware a tad pricey for what you get. $18 for catfish and shrimp with brussel sprouts and no salad to start.

    Nicole S.

    My boyfriend and I stopped here for lunch after coming to Ville Platte for some smoked sausage. The building is a beautifully restored bank building. Both the interior appointments and the exterior have been cleaned up and nicely restored to showcase the original structure and fixturing. I ordered the chicken and andouille gumbo with a house salad, and my boyfriend had the fried catfish and shrimp entree. Both meals were delivered quickly and were of excellent quality with just the right amount of seasoning you would expect from a south Louisiana restaurant. We will definitely return and would recommend this restaurant to any visitors in the area.

    Ask the Community - Cafe Evangeline

    Is the a good place for cajun food and fried fish?

    The food is amazing. They have Cajun food and fried fish. I always get the stuffed chicken with Gouda grits. And the chicken and stuffed with sausage and other spices. Amazing flavor.
